Administrative Assistant II
Weyerhaeuser’s Greenville, NC lumber facility—a random-length sawmill producing lumber up to 20 feet with specialty capacity—is located in northeastern North Carolina, offering small-town charm, outdoor recreation, and proximity to colleges, shopping, and arts/entertainment in neighboring cities.
Responsibilities
- Enter data for the Daily Production Report and serve as backup administrative support.
- Provide comprehensive administrative support to the management team.
- Manage and coordinate office communications, including emails, phone calls, and mail.
- Oversee day-to-day office operations, ensuring a clean and organized workspace.
- Maintain office supplies inventory and reorder as needed.
- Coordinate office events, meetings, and appointments.
- Accurately input and manage data using office software and databases.
- Maintain organized and up-to-date records, both physical and digital.
- Serve as the first point of contact for visitors and vendors, providing excellent customer service.
- Assist with basic financial tasks such as expense tracking and budget monitoring.
- Monitor payroll records to ensure accurate payment to employees.
- Act as a center of expertise for associates’ pay-related questions.
- Manage Log Consumption Daily and adjust as needed (SAP).
- Complete monthly closing for GV & PL mills.
- Support various projects by coordinating tasks, tracking progress, and ensuring deadlines are met.
- Proactively identify and resolve issues in the office environment.
- Multitask efficiently with a positive attitude and read/understand pay statements.

Pay
Target salary range: $50,000–$75,100, based on skills, qualifications, and experience. Eligible for an Annual Incentive Program with a cash bonus targeting 5% of base pay (potential funding ranges from zero to two times the target).
Benefits
- Comprehensive medical, dental, vision, short- and long-term disability, and life insurance.
- Pre-tax Health Savings Account with company contribution.
- Voluntary Long-Term Care and Employee Assistance Programs.
- Support for personal volunteerism, diversity networks, mentoring, and training/development.
- 401k plan with company match and an annual contribution equal to 5% of base salary.
- 3 weeks of paid vacation in the first year, accrual begins after six months.
- 11 paid holidays (88 hours) and paid parental leave for all full-time employees.
